The suona, one of China's national wind instruments, is also a folk instrument widely circulated throughout China.

The suona has a bright, loud tone and a wooden, conical body, with a brass tube with a whistle at the upper end and a brass bell (called a bowl) over the lower end, hence the common name horn. In Taiwan, it is known as the drum blow; in Guangdong, it is also known as the tic-tac, which is one of the "eight tones" of Guangdong.

The suona is a high-pitched, loud and clear sounding instrument, which has been used in the past in folk songs, rice-planting songs, drumming classes, and the accompaniment of local music and operas. After continuous development, rich playing skills, improve the expressive power, has become a solo instrument with characteristics, and used for national band ensemble or opera, song and dance accompaniment.
